An Examination Of The Practice Of Aligning Speech-Language Therapy Goals To The Common Core State Standards For English Language Arts, Gerard Francis Shine
Theses and Dissertations
Implementation of the Common Core State Standards (CCSS) is now a curriculum priority for school districts across the United States. Speech-language pathologists (SLPs) are exploring ways to incorporate the CCSS into their assessment and therapy practices. Literature centered on the development of language goals aligned with the CCSS for English language arts (ELA) was limited. The purpose of this study was to identify if SLPs working in public elementary and middle school settings had adopted the practice of aligning their language-intervention goals to the CCSS for ELA for students on their caseloads. Leading Curricular Change: The Role Of The School Principal In Implementation Of The Common Core State Standards, Tiffany Marie Squires
Dissertations - ALL
Principals, whose jobs are increasingly being reframed as requiring instructional leadership (Lunenburg, 2013; Hallinger, 2005), serve as a vital link between standards-based reform and its successful implementation at the school level (Fullan, 2011; Hallinger & Heck, 1996; Leithwood & Riehl, 2005; Spillane & Hunt, 2010). Standards-based reform or guidelines for change mandated by state government significantly influence teaching and learning (Beane, 2013). Our nation’s latest iteration of standards-based reform is comprised within the Common Core State Standards (CCSS), which are currently fully implemented in 42 states. Emergent Themes Surrounding The Implementation Of The Common Core State Standards For Mathematics For Students With Learning Disabilities In Mathematics, Andrew R. Mills
All NMU Master's Theses
As the nation transitions into a new national curriculum, the Common Core State Standards for Mathematics (CCSSM), educators face the challenge of meeting the needs of a diverse student population coupled with a change in standards. The purpose of this phenomenological study was to understand educators’ perceptions surrounding the implementation of these standards specific to students with learning disabilities in mathematics. Five rural, middle school educators were interviewed using a series of questions that investigated their experiences related to implementation of the CCSSM. Interviews were recorded and transcribed. Success After Failure: An Examination Of Credit Recovery Options And Their Effect On College- And Career-Readiness, Kathryn B. Johnson
Theses and Dissertations--Science, Technology, Engineering, and Mathematics (STEM) Education
More than ever before, educators and researchers are keeping a keen eye on student college- and career-readiness. The widely adopted Common Core State Standards were written with the explicit goal of helping students to be college- or career-ready by the time they graduate from high school. However, many students experience setbacks, such as course failure, within their educational career placing them at risk for not reaching this goal. Because the ACT can predict student success in college, states often use benchmark scores from the exam to measure student college- and career-readiness. A Study Of The Level Of Integration Of Common Core State Standards In West Virginia Teacher Preparation Programs, Georgia Nicole Thornton
Theses, Dissertations and Capstones
This study examined the level of integration of the Common Core State Standards (CCSS) within the population of 164 teacher preparation faculty members in 18 initial teacher preparation programs in West Virginia. A three part researcher developed survey was mailed to each dean/director for distribution to the initial teacher professional education faculty. Deans/directors were also given the option of participating in a follow up interview and were asked a series of questions based on a researcher developed interview protocol.
In general, initial teacher professional education faculty members described their level of integration of CCSS as between some and significant integration. …

Progression Of Elementary Teachers In Implementing Language Arts Common Core State Standards, Holly Franks Boffy
Walden Dissertations and Doctoral Studies
The challenges of implementing the Common Core State Standards at the classroom level resulted in political pushback to the reform initiative after the local media covered poor implementation decisions. This study explored how elementary school teachers and instructional leaders described teachers' progress along the implementation continuum for the standards. The concerns-based adoption model served as the conceptual framework for this study. This multicase study design consisted of 16 interviews of teachers and instructional leaders from 4 schools. Investigating The English Language Arts Placement Of Struggling High School Freshmen, Pamela Burke-Haug
Walden Dissertations and Doctoral Studies
This qualitative case study addressed a suburban school district's placement of academically at-risk English language arts (ELA) 9th graders as the district transitions from the New Jersey Assessment of Skills and Knowledge (NJASK) to use of the unfamiliar and controversial Partnership for Assessment of Readiness for College and Careers (PARCC). Based on the theoretical frameworks of the zone of proximal development, cognitive apprenticeship, and Bandura's model of self-efficacy, the purpose was to understand the characteristics of struggling (labeled 'academic') ELA students, placement practices and perceptions of these practices, and placement improvements. The Relationship Between Science Curriculum Aligned To Common Core State Standards And Scientific Literacy, Amber Lee Struthers
Walden Dissertations and Doctoral Studies
Supporting the development of scientifically literate students is a priority in public school education, and understanding how that development is influenced by the Common Core State Standards is vital to quality science education. However, little quantitative research has been conducted about how the Common Core State Standards impact science education. The purpose of this quasi-experimental study was to determine how the alignment of science curriculum and instruction to the Common Core English Language Arts State Standards impacts the development of students' scientific literacy skills.
